In 2019-2020, 821 people earned their degree in medical scientist, making the major the 495th most popular in the United States.

Across Minnesota, there were 51 medical scientist gra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 42 medical scientist graduates with average earnings and debt of $55,396 and $40,953 respectively.

Mayo Clinic School of Medicine

Rochester, Minnesota
#1 in overall quality

Out of the 2 schools in the Best Value Medical Scientist Schools for a Master’s in Minnesota For Those Getting Aid that were part of this year’s ranking, Mayo Clinic School of Medicine landed the #1 spot on the list. Mayo Clinic School of Medicine is a small private not-for-profit school situated in Rochester, Minnesota. It awarded 30 masters’s medical scientist degrees in 2019-2020.

In addition to being on our minnesota master’s degree medical scientist students with aid list, Mayo Clinic School of Medicine has also earned the #1 rank in our “Best Medical Scientist Master’s Degree Schools in Minnesota” ranking. Average graduate tuition and fees at Mayo Clinic School of Medicine are $20,837, but some majors have different tuition rates.

Saint Cloud State University

Saint Cloud, Minnesota
#2 in overall quality

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Saint Cloud State University. It ranked #2 on our 2022 Best Value Medical Scientist Schools for a Master’s in Minnesota For Those Getting Aid list. Saint Cloud, Minnesota is the setting for this fairly large institution of higher learning. The public school handed out masters’s medical scientist degrees to 12 students in 2019-2020.

St. Cloud State University did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#2 on our “Best Medical Scientist Master’s Degree Schools in Minnesota”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at Saint Cloud State University are $12,904,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
